Tiger Canyon Porcoolpine fanless Tiger Lake NUC announced for $679 and up

Fanless Tiger Lake NUC

Simply NUC “Tiger Canyon Porcoolpine” is a fanless Intel NUC offered with a choice of Tiger Lake UP3 processors, notably Core i3-1115G4, Core i5-1135G7, and Core i7-1165G7, and equivalent vPro parts when available. The mini PC comes with up to 64GB DDR4, NVMe & SATA storage, a Thunderbolt 4 port, two HDMI 2.0b ports, 2.5 GbE networking, and optional Wi-Fi 6 and Bluetooth 5.1, as well as a DB9 serial port for industrial applications, for example, to connect a barcode scanner. Raspberry Pi 4 gets IEEE1588 Precision Time Protocol (PTP) with Real-Time HAT

Raspberrry Pi 4 PTP protocol with the real-time HAT

InnoRoute Real-Time HAT adds IEEE1588 Precision Time Protocol (PTP) to Raspberry Pi 4/3 via a Xilinx Artix-7 FPGA and three Gigabit Ethernet ports. The Precision Time Protocol (PTP) is used to very accurately synchronize clocks throughout a computer network to enable measurement and control systems. It is often found in embedded microcontrollers or processors from Texas Instruments, STMicro, and more recently, in Intel Elkhart Lake & Tiger Lake H processors. It can notably be used for Time-Sensitive Networking (TSN) and Audio Video Bridging (AVB). 5G compatible Arm Pico-ITX SBC is expandable through multi-function I/O board

IBASE IBR215 SBC plus IO expansion board

IBASE IBR215 is a 2.5-inch Pico-ITX SBC powered by NXP i.MX 8M Plus quad-core ARM Cortex-A53 AI processor that supports 5G cellular connectivity via an M.2 3052 socket, and can be extended with an I/O expansion board with support for WiFi/BT, 4G/LTE, LCD, camera, NFC & QR-code functions. Equipped with up to 4GB RAM and 128GB flash storage, the single board computer has a ruggedized and fanless design that makes it suitable for industrial automation, smart home and buildings, smart cities and factories, retail environment, machine learning, and other industrial IoT applications. MiTAC introduces Intel Elkhart Lake & Comet Lake thin Mini-ITX motherboards

Comet Lake Thin-mini ITX motherboard

MiTAC has unveiled three industrial thin mini-ITX motherboards based on Elkhart Lake and Comet Lake processors with respectively MiTAC PD10EHI with a choice of low-power Intel Atom, Celeron and Pentium Elkhart Lake processors, and two more powerful motherboards with MiTAC PH11CMI & PH12CMI based on up to an Intel Core i9 Comet Lake processor, and which are virtually identical except for a different chipset allowing vPro features and RAID support. UP Xtreme i11 Tiger Lake SBC launched for $299 and up

UP Xtreme i11 Tiger Lake-SBC with AI accelerator

Ever since the launch of Intel Atom Cherry Trail powered Up Board SBC in 2015, AAEON has kept launching more UP boards with faster, yet still low power processors, as well as complete turnkey solutions based on their x86 SBC such as the UP Xtreme Smart Surveillance kit. The company has now started taking pre-orders for the UP Xtreme i11 Tiger Lake SBC, and a UP Xtreme i11 Edge Compute Enabling kit mini PC based on the board will become available in Q3 2021. The board features a choice of Intel 11th generation Tiger Lake Embedded “GRE” Core or Celeron processors, an Intel Altera MAX V FPGA, up to 64GB RAM, Gigabit Ethernet, 2.5GbE networking, and more. Cincoze GP-3000 review – An expandable Xeon-based GPU computer

cincoze gp-3000 review

Cincoze GP-3000 is an expandable high-performance GPU computer. It consists of either a 9th or 8th generation Intel processor-powered embedded computer which can be expanded with Cincoze’s proprietary GPU Expansion Box (GEB) capable of housing up to dual 250W full-length graphic cards. Additional I/O expansion is also possible through the use of various modules. With a total 720W power budget the GP-3000’s additional GPU performance massively accelerates complex industrial AI and machine vision tasks. As a rugged computer, the GP-3000 has passed a series of stringent quality assurance tests and industry standards including MIL-STD-810G military standard, E-mark for in-vehicle applications, and EN50155 (EN 50121-3-2 only) for rolling stock environments. It can withstand hot and cold temperature extremes, shock and vibration, and high electromagnetic radiation. 25-45W Intel Tiger Lake-H Xeon, Core, and Celeron embedded processors coming soon

Intel Tiger Lake-H module block diagram

While doing some research, I noticed an Intel Core i7-11850HE “Tiger Lake-H” processor on the OpenVino Toolkit website. Parts that end with “E” are usually processors designed for the embedded market. I had never heard about the Tiger Lake-H embedded family, so I looked for “i7-11850HE” processor, and it’s not in Intel Ark, or much anywhere else except on a page in Google Cache, about a COM-HPC module “with the 11th Gen Intel® Xeon® W-11000E Series, Core™ vPro® and Celeron® processors (formerly Tiger Lake-H) for FuSa application”. Industrial Android/Linux mini PC ships with optional HDMI input, DTV tuner, 4G LTE modem

Industrial Android mini PC with HDMI input, ATSC, 4G modem

We’re seeing several companies known for their Android TV boxes switch to higher-margin industrial Android/Linux mini PCs with, for instance, Zidoo M6 mini PC powered by Rockchip RK3566 processor and designed for IoT applications, digital signage, and more. Geniatech APC820 is another industrial mini PC running either Android or Linux, on the older, yet more powerful Rockchip RK3399 SoC, and offering a different set of options including 4K or Full HD HDMI input, digital TV tuner, and/or a 4G LTE modem.
